Hamas officials say time for temporary truce is over

Senior Hamas officials said Thursday morning that Israel presented a proposal for the release of hostages and an end to the fighting in the Gaza Strip, in the wake of a similar report the previous evening in the Wall Street Journal. The chiefs added that the proposal revolves around a seven-day cease-fire, and noted that the Palestinian factions in the Gaza Strip, led by Hamas, said in response to the proposal that "the time for a temporary truce is over."
